Abstract
The present invention relates to systems and methods for configuring a data storage system. One method adds a Fibre Channel device to the loop by beaconing first and second ports, displaying instructions to connect a cable, receiving an indication the cable is connected, enabling the first port, initiating a LIP, and verifying whether the cable is connected. Another method removes a Fibre Channel device from the loop by beaconing the second port, bypassing the first port, initiating a LIP, beaconing the first port, displaying instructions for disconnecting the cable, and receiving an indication the cable is disconnected. A system includes means for displaying instructions to add a Fibre Channel device on the loop and a management controller for beaconing first and second ports, displaying instructions to connect a cable, receiving an indication that the cable is connected, enabling the first port, initiating a LIP, and verifying whether the cable is connected properly. Another system includes means for displaying instructions to remove a Fibre Channel device from the loop and a management controller programmed for beaconing the second port, bypassing the first port, initiating a LIP, beaconing the first port, displaying instructions to disconnect a cable, receiving an indication that the cable is disconnected, and verifying whether the cable is disconnected.

14. A method of configuring a data storage system processing I/O requests and having active data traffic on a Fibre Channel loop including a cable connecting a first port to a second port, comprising:
-
(a) beaconing the second port; (b) bypassing the first port; (c) initiating a LIP on the Fibre Channel loop having the bypassed first port; (d) beaconing the first port; (e) displaying instructions for disconnecting the cable between the first port and the second port; (f) receiving an indication that the cable is disconnected; and (g) suspending the active data traffic on the Fibre Channel loop before step (b) and resuming the active data traffic on the Fibre Channel loop after step (c). - View Dependent Claims (15, 16, 17, 18, 19, 20, 21, 22, 23)
